I am pleased to offer the following 1880/79-CC Rev '78 (VAM-4) PCGS MS-63 Morgan Dollar for sale to forum members only on the BS&T Forum for the published PCGS Price Guide price of $625 (including S/H/I).
This coin has all of the Morgan Dollar attributes that are most attractive to VAM Collectors, including boldly visible 80/79 (VAM-4) Overdate, First Reverse Design of the original 1878 inaugural issue year, and of course the historic Carson City mintmark.
I am selling this attractive specimen from my PCGS Morgan Dollar Variety Registry Set because I recently upgraded to an MS-64.
